A shooting incident occurred at Fort Stewart-Hunter Army Airfield in Georgia, resulting in injuries to five soldiers. The base was immediately placed on lockdown as a precautionary measure to ensure the safety of all personnel and to allow authorities to conduct a thorough investigation. The swift response by military police and emergency services helped contain the situation quickly.
The suspected shooter was apprehended shortly after the incident, and authorities have confirmed that there is no ongoing threat to the base or surrounding areas. The identity of the shooter has not been disclosed, and motives behind the attack remain under investigation. The military is working closely with local law enforcement to gather all necessary evidence and testimonies.
